Natalie budgets $146 for yoga training. She buys a yoga mat for $10 and spends $9 per day on yoga classes. Which inequality represents the number of days, d, that Natalie can take classes and stay within her budget?
A 146 ≤ 9d + 10
B 146 ≥ 9d + 10
C 146 ≤ 10d + 9
D 146 ≥ 10d + 9
